$15Interested in starting a small farm? Wonder what it would take, and if you’re ready? Whether you’re in the planning stages or have just begun, this 3hr self-paced online workshop is designed to help you explore the development of a small farm enterprise and create a plan of action for achieving your small farm goals.

Learning Objectives
- Reflect on personal motivations and lifestyle preferences related to farming.
- Identify key resources needed to start or expand a farm.
- Explore different types of farm enterprises and sustainable agriculture practices.
- Assess readiness and develop a personalized action plan for next steps.
Course Topics
- Washington Small Farms Overview
- What is Sustainable Agriculture?
- Personal Inventory and Resource Review
- Farmer Panel: Surviving the First Years
- Enterprise Exploration & Action Planning
- Resources & Upcoming Opportunities
